ACI 440.2R-17 FRP Strengthening Calculator

Web application for designing externally bonded FRP (Fiber-Reinforced Polymer) strengthening of RC beams and slabs per ACI 440.2R-17.

Features

Flexural Strengthening

  • Full ACI 440.2R-17 flexural design with iterative neutral axis solver (20 iterations)
  • Support for Carbon (CFRP), Glass (GFRP), and Aramid (AFRP) fiber types
  • Environmental exposure conditions: Interior, Exterior, Aggressive
  • Service stress checks (steel and FRP creep rupture)
  • Detailed MathJax-rendered calculation report with all intermediate steps

Shear Strengthening

  • ACI 440.2R-17 Chapter 11 shear design
  • U-wrap (3 sides) and two-sided wrapping configurations
  • Effective bond length, bond reduction factors, and strain calculations
  • Combined shear capacity (FRP + concrete + steel)

General

  • Interactive SVG beam cross-section diagram
  • Summary cards with pass/fail indicators
  • Tabbed interface (Flexural / Shear)
  • Electron.js desktop app wrapper
  • Railway-ready deployment (Docker)

Quick Start

Web (Development)

pip install -r requirements.txt
python app.py

Open http://localhost:5000

Electron (Desktop)

npm install
npm run electron

Railway Deployment

Push to GitHub and connect to Railway. It auto-deploys via the included Dockerfile.
